I used to live in the Midwest, and so met with temps comparable to yours in Vermont. I ran 5W-30 in a 240 series car in the winter, and switched to 10W30 in the summer.

A lighter weight oil makes sense in extreme cold: it will be less viscous and so get to where its needed faster. It will also ease strain on the starter/battery.

That said, I would not run 0w-40 in the summer: it is too thin for the heat of a Vermont summer. I would switch to 10W30 about 1 April and keep it in until 1 December, or a tad later.

I use Mobil1 10W30 year-round, here in the northeast, as my car is almost always garaged. As a result, the block temp does not drop to ambient.
